Somalia: Federal Govt forces attack Al Shabaab base in Bay

Image

BARDALE, Somalia, May 26, 2015 (Garowe Online)-Somali government forces clashed with Al Shabaab militants near Bay regional district of Bardale of southwestern Somalia, killing two fighters according to official, Garowe Online reports.

Bardale mayor, Mohamed Isaq Arro-Ase told VOA Somali Service that government troops raided Al Shabaab bases in Bardale as part of cleanup operation.

Arro-Ase added that they are in control of areas where the skirmishes occurred.

Al Shabaab has yet to comment on the deadly clashes in Bay.

The Somali militant group maintains stronger presence in Bay and Bakool regions.

Southwest state administration alongside African Union peacekeepers is planning to liberate Al Shabaab-held areas.

Militants fled a string of strategic towns in central and southern Somalia as a result of intense military campaign by allied forces.
